The Supportive Living Program (SLP) Community Integration Program provides services that support an individual’s activities of daily living in the community, social and independent skills development.
Providing organization
Spokane County Supportive Living Program (SLP)
The Supportive Living Program has been providing critical services to individuals over 18 who are homeless with serious or chronic mental illness.
